Output 14f78e88be953194ce17851613f0c2ac113b1feaebb8ced08e4d486dc45e245a:5

value
1980907
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dc3183722bd6db3b890591e868c8cd5603dfc59c OP_EQUAL
address
3MmHu153YNr1Z6v3ZqjtyqvyijabXkYtg1
transaction
14f78e88be953194ce17851613f0c2ac113b1feaebb8ced08e4d486dc45e245a
spent
true